I live in Valparaiso, and installed XM radio in my 4-runner. I put the antenna front center hood, right above the mirror, outside the car. I ran the wire down the trough, and covered it with black RTV silicone. I did the same installation on my Corolla. I have had great reception with both vehicles. On my new TCH, I have factory XM installed, and the antenna is inside the vehicle on the rear deck next to the brake light. The reception is good, but not as good as the 4-runner. There are more "drop-out" areas due to the roof. If I had my choice on the camry, it would be either rooftop center above the driver's mirror, or top center truck lid (I think someone in another thread posted a picture of this).
